32 minutes ago, Frobby said:

Knight had his best night in a very long time: 7 IP, 5 H, 2 R, 2 ER, 2 BB, 5 K’s.   Coupled with his pretty decent start last outing, maybe he’s made some adjustments.    I’ll be watching to see if he makes further progress in August.   

Knight had his best stuff of the season  tonight I think. He was 93-94 t95 with riding armside life. The curveball was particularly sharp and he threw some good sliders and changeups too. Command was below average at best though. I don't think he hit a spot all night.

2 hours ago, RZNJ said:

What would you like the real Blaine Knight to be seen as?   It's tough to figure the dominance at Delmarva with the ineptitude at Frederick.  It doesn't seem like most prospects have quite the same difficulty with that jump.  

He wasn’t nearly as good as the results in Delmarva and isn’t as bad as the results in Frederick. Plus older hitters taking more advantage his fringe to below average command (which was apparent in Delmarva) and going from a pitcher’s park to an extreme hitter’s park.

He’s flashed legit stuff, but I think he’s a reliever.
